NPP Party Executives Not Engaging- Dr. Amoako Baah

Political Scientist, Dr. Richard Amoako Baah

Political Scientist, Dr. Richard Amoako Baah, has intimated that the New Patriotic Party(NPP) executives are not engaging, hence the recent misunderstanding and controversies in the party.

The Political scientist averred that the party executives are failing in ensuring the right thing is done in the party.

Speaking on the race for flagbearership and executive positions in the NPP causing controversies, he disagreed with the assertion that some executive members are being imposed on the party.

“I don’t think anybody is imposing anything. It’s just that the party executives are failing. They don’t have the means of engagement. By now they should have met all the candidates aspiring, talk to them and give them some ground rules of engagement.”

Dr. Richard Amoako Baah

According to Dr. Amoako Baah, even though there is a constitution in the party, the engagement is very much needed, because it will in the end help them agree on how they are going to conduct themselves.

“The way things are now, they want events to overtake them before they react. That is not good. We saw some of these things in the 2020 elections and that should not be happening again.”

Dr. Richard Amoako Baah
Mr Kennedy Agyapong
Assin Central MP, Kennedy Agyapong

His comments follow an assertion by the Assin Central MP, Kennedy Agyapong, that the NPP is imposing some executive members of the party on members and could cause another worse “skirt and blouse” situation and the party risk losing in the next election come 2024.

Party not ready for next election

Dr. Amoako Baah averred that with the recent happenings in the party, he cannot say the party is ready for the next general election in 2024.

“That’s why I am saying that there should have been a forum so each of them speak so there can be cordiality, but nobody is doing that.”

Dr. Richard Amoako Baah

The political scientist intimated that the behavior of some of the party executives coupled with the misunderstandings can cause the party to lose in the next election.

“The party is not doing well. Look around you. This e-levy is the last stand they have, if it falls through, we are in big trouble. The government has put all its eggs in one basket and that is not appropriate. I want to say it is a lazy way of doing things.”

Dr. Richard Amoako Baah

Touching on the current push for the passage of the E-levy, he intimated that government should consider other means of revenue generation for the country. He posited that there are so many ways government can raise money aside the E-levy.

“Why are you going to take somebody’s money because they are using electronic money and when another person spends the same money in cash, you don’t take anything from them? That is the problem I have with them because the E-levy is like fishing in the barrel.”

Dr. Richard Amoako Baah

The political scientist stated that he suspects that the E-levy passage was going to be used as collateral to borrow money and that money was what was going to sustain the government.
